
Not every meaningful moment arrives with grand gestures or life-changing events. More often, the things that leave the deepest impact are the quiet acts of kindness woven into everyday life. A simple message, an unexpected invitation, a shared laugh, or a song sent for no particular reason can remind us that we matter to someone. These moments may seem small on the surface, but they carry a powerful sense of connection, belonging, and care.
A Simple “Home Safe?” Message
A message asking, “Home safe?” is more than a routine check-in. It reflects concern, thoughtfulness, and the quiet reassurance that someone is thinking about you even after the conversation ends. In a busy world, knowing that someone cares about your well-being enough to wait for that reply can make you feel valued and remembered.

Remembering the Little Details:
There is something special about a person who remembers your coffee order, favorite snack, or small preferences without needing a reminder. These details may seem insignificant, yet they reveal genuine attention and care. Being remembered in this way shows that someone listens, notices, and keeps pieces of you in their everyday thoughts.

The Healing Power of Easy Laughter:
Some of the best moments happen when laughter comes naturally. Sitting with friends, sharing stories, and losing track of time can create a sense of peace that often goes unnoticed. Sometimes, you only realize later that you’ve been feeling okay for a while that joy quietly found its way back through simple moments of connection and companionship.

Being Included Without Having to Ask:
There’s something deeply comforting about being included naturally. Not having to wonder whether you’re invited, not having to ask if you can come, and not feeling like an afterthought. A simple message like “We’re on our way” instead of “Are you coming?” says more than people realize. It communicates belonging, acceptance, and the feeling that your presence was already expected. The smallest acts of inclusion can make someone feel seen and valued in ways that last far beyond the moment itself.

A Playlist That Says “I Thought of You”:
Music has a unique way of carrying emotions that are difficult to put into words. That’s why a playlist created for no special occasion can feel incredibly meaningful. When someone sends a song or puts together a collection of tracks simply because it reminded them of you, it becomes more than music. It becomes proof that you crossed their mind during an ordinary moment of their day. These thoughtful gestures aren’t about the playlist itself they’re about knowing someone cared enough to think of you when you weren’t even there.

One of life’s quiet but powerful realizations is understanding that genuine relationships don’t require constant performance. Whether in friendships, family bonds, or love, true connection isn’t earned through perfection or endless proving. Being valued for who you are not for what you achieve, provide, or pretend to be creates a sense of freedom that many people spend years searching for. It’s a small realization on the surface, but it changes how we show up in every relationship.

Final Thoughts:
The beauty of life is often found in the moments we overlook. They remind us that being cared for isn’t always loud or obvious. Sometimes, love, friendship, and appreciation reveal themselves through the smallest actions. And that’s why the little things aren’t little at all; they’re often the moments that mean the most.
